MORTON BERSON: Newspaper Obituary and Death Notice

Post-Standard, The (Syracuse, NY) - Saturday, January 12, 2002
Deceased Name: MORTON BERSON

Morton Berson, 80, of 112 Kendall Drive W., East Syracuse, died Friday. Born in Syracuse, he graduated from Vocational High School in 1941. He was an electrical technician for AM Food & Vending. He was a member of Limestone Tennis League. He was an Army veteran of World War II and served in the Pacific with the anti-tank company of the 32nd infantry, 7th division.

Survivors: His wife, the former Leona Boyd; two daughters, Beth Drogozewski of DeWitt and Adrian Marino of Liverpool; two sisters, Ruth and Bernice Berson, both of Syracuse; two brothers, Sidney and William, both of Syracuse; four grandchildren; two great-grandchildren. Services: 11 a.m. Monday at Birnbaum Funeral Chapel. Burial, Onondaga County Veterans Memorial Cemetery. Calling hour, 10 to 11 a.m. Monday at the funeral home, 1909 E. Fayette St., Syracuse. Contributions: Temple Adath Yeshurun, 450 Kimber Road, Syracuse 13224.
